What does a Senior Producer do at WPP Production?

The Senior Producer will be a creative production critical thinker, elevating each project regardless of scale. The Senior Producer will contribute to the maintenance and growth of strong team, client and agency relationships, producing work that is distinct, consistent and honours the level of style and craftsmanship that goes into every touchpoint that makes up our brands. The ideal candidate will have ambitions that push the production and technological limits on all projects and be experienced across integrated platforms, consistently delivering on time, in budget and to the highest level of creative standards.

The Senior Producer is responsible for leading the development of each project and ensuring they are completed on time and within budget. This role requires exceptional planning and organisational skills to manage the agency, client and vendor relationships and responsibilities during production, liaising between the agency and suppliers and maintaining fair processes while communicating clearly and positively to deliver our product successfully.

The Senior Producer will plan, schedule and control project production objectives, adhering to client, agency and industry standards, and on set will facilitate all communication between the agency, client and production partners.

In this role you will be …
  • Responsible for excellence in all day‑to‑day activities including scoping and ball‑parking creative concepts, breaking down scripts, building detailed project schedules, managing project scope, researching and securing the best production resources, quality‑controlling all deliverables, maintaining project documentation and communicating with project teams through final delivery.
  • Able to contribute to the elevation of the creative product through active participation with the team.
  • Supportive, inspiring and educating on production opportunities that apply to each project.
  • Aware of top industry trends, techniques, directors, cinematographers, GCI, AI and new technologies in an effort to elevate the creative product.
  • Responsible for building critical relationships and maintaining the agency’s reputation and standard of excellence within the production industry, while keeping an active knowledge of cross‑discipline external partners.
  • Able to manage multiple, often concurrent, projects.
  • Trusted to lead workload independently, managing up to the Head of Production or EP when needed or appropriate.
  • Capable of selecting and negotiating with the appropriate partners based on creative scope, budget and timeline, and identifying which partner best suits the creative vision.
  • Knowledgeable of compliance and client legal guidelines.
  • Able to leverage experience to proactively predict issues and guide the team away from avoidable challenges during all stages of production.
